数学建模背后的数学

时间:2013-12-11 18:09:33

标签: data-modeling data-warehouse

什么样的数学概念(例如图论)是通过理解数据建模和数据仓库概念和设计的必备读物?

1 个答案:

答案 0 :(得分:2)

我不会说任何必要的必然。我发现以下内容很有用:

  1. The Relational Model。几乎所有RDBMS都基于的理论。
  2. First Order Predicate Logic。关系模型的理论基础
  3. Set Theory。除其他外,理解集合之间的不同关系是好的:联合,交集,差异。这些都在关系模型中有直接的类比。
  4. Graph Theory。可能是我发现对数据建模本身最不实用的那个。然而(1)我已经首先介绍了上述内容,(2)它有助于理解数据模型遍历(例如传递闭包)。
  5. 我会在上面提醒我。我既不是数学家,也不是计算机科学家,所以我从实证者的立场出发。精通那些领域的人无疑会提供基于更强大理论基础的建议。

    除了理论之外,还有一些好的书籍将理论基础与实际考虑相结合; e.g。

    1. SQL and Relational Theory(Chris Date)。出色的理论书。唯一的缺点:日期不是SQL的粉丝,并且反复提出他的观点,这确实有点令人厌烦。但它仍然是一本很棒的书。
    2. Data Modeling Essentials(Simsion& Witt)。真是好书。也很好地涵盖了理论,特别是关系模型中的不同范式。
    3. 第h